Source code for _errortools.logging.record

"""Log record — the structured object passed to every sink."""

from __future__ import annotations

import sys
import threading
import traceback
from dataclasses import dataclass, field
from datetime import datetime
from types import TracebackType
from typing import Any, Union

if sys.version_info >= (3, 9):
    from datetime import UTC
else:
    from datetime import timezone

    UTC = timezone.utc

from .level import Level


[docs] @dataclass class Record: """Immutable snapshot of a single log event. Mirrors loguru's record dict but as a typed dataclass. Attributes: time: UTC timestamp when the record was created. level: The `logging.level.Level` of this event. message: The formatted log message (after ``str.format`` / f-string). name: Logger name (set by the caller or auto-detected). file: Source file name (``__file__``). line: Source line number. function: Calling function name. thread_id: OS thread identifier. thread_name: Thread name. process_id: OS process id. exception: The active exception info tuple, or ``None``. extra: Arbitrary key/value context bound via ``logger.bind()``. """ time: datetime level: Level message: str name: str file: str line: int function: str thread_id: int thread_name: str process_id: int exception: Union[tuple[type[BaseException], BaseException, Union[TracebackType, None]], None] extra: dict[str, Any] = field(default_factory=dict) # ------------------------------------------------------------------ # Convenience helpers # ------------------------------------------------------------------ @property def exc_text(self) -> Union[str, None]: """Formatted traceback string, or ``None`` if no exception.""" if self.exception is None: return None return "".join(traceback.format_exception(*self.exception)) def __str__(self) -> str: return self.message
def _current_frame_info(depth: int = 2) -> tuple[str, int, str]: """Return (filename, lineno, function_name) *depth* frames up the call stack.""" frame = sys._getframe(depth) return frame.f_code.co_filename, frame.f_lineno, frame.f_code.co_name def make_record( level: Level, message: str, name: str, depth: int, exception: bool, extra: dict[str, Any], ) -> Record: """Build a `Record` for the given log call. Args: level: Log level. message: Already-formatted message string. name: Logger name. depth: How many frames to skip when locating caller info. exception: Whether to capture the current exception info. extra: Bound context from ``logger.bind()``. """ file, line, func = _current_frame_info(depth) exc_info = sys.exc_info() if exception else None if exc_info == (None, None, None): exc_info = None t = threading.current_thread() import os return Record( time=datetime.now(UTC), level=level, message=message, name=name, file=file, line=line, function=func, thread_id=t.ident or 0, thread_name=t.name, process_id=os.getpid(), exception=exc_info, # type: ignore[arg-type] extra=dict(extra), )
